Witness the rugged landscape of the Red Centre and marvel at the ancient cultures that have cared for this land for generations. Experience the majesty of Uluru, Kata Tjuta, Kings Canyon, and explore Simpsons Gap in the West MacDonnell Ranges.

Meeting your Driver Guide

Explore the vibrant culture and rich history of Alice Springs with a tailored itinerary that promises unforgettable experiences. Begin by meeting your insightful Driver Guide, who will provide a unique perspective on life in this remote town. Discover the history of the region at the iconic Overland Telegraph Station, then delve into the world of Indigenous culture with an exclusive MAKE TRAVEL MATTER® Experience led by Rayleen Brown. Rayleen’s recipes have been featured in many Australian cookbooks, and she has served as a guest judge on renowned culinary TV shows. She will share her knowledge of Aboriginal native foods with you, followed, of course, by a tasting of the many flavours of this region’s bush tucker.

Alice Springs

Begin your adventure from Alice Springs, heading towards the majestic Kings Canyon. Along the way, stop at a charming roadhouse at Erldunda, known as the "Centre of the Centre," where the Stuart and Lasseter Highways meet. Continue your journey to Kings Canyon Resort, nestled in the heart of Watarrka National Park. This resort offers modern amenities, including a pool, restaurant, and comfortable deluxe lodge rooms. As night falls, indulge in the "Under a Desert Moon" dinner, a unique five-course dining experience under the stars, featuring locally sourced produce and fine Australian wines. This unforgettable evening is the perfect end to a day of exploration and discovery in the Red Centre.

Kings Canyon

Gaze across the deep chasm at the edge of Kings Canyon as you embark on a 6km sunrise Rim Walk, past the sandstone domes of the 'Lost City' and down the stairs to the lush 'Garden of Eden'. Or you can opt for a gentler stroll along the canyon creek bed, treading in the footsteps of the Luritja people who once found sanctuary amidst the Itara trees at the canyon’s base. Then head off towards Uluru, visiting the local Wanmarra Community to learn about the Luritja and Pertame people's spiritual connection to the land, at the Karrke Aboriginal Cultural MAKE TRAVEL MATTER® Experience. Discover bush food and medicine used for spirituality and healing. Now you'll journey across desert landscapes to Curtin Springs Station, a vast farming property. Feel the stirring of something bigger than you as you arrive at the world-famous Uluru. Uncover the foundations of Anangu culture and the important creation stories of how Uluru was formed, as you spend time wandering through the Cultural Centre before arriving at the resort. Indigenous sacred site

You may choose to sleep in or better still, start your day with the breathtaking Sunrise Field of Light experience by Artist Bruce Munro (own expense). Then, venture to Kata Tjuta for a morning of exploration and awe-inspiring landscapes as you wander through Walpa Gorge. Enjoy some free time for lunch before embarking on a tour at the base of Uluru, delving into the rich cultural significance of this sacred site. Cap off your day with sunset drinks, soaking in the vibrant colours of the Outback and the changing hues of Uluru as the sun sets. The evening is yours to unwind and enjoy at leisure.

Sunset celebratory dinner

Travel through the vast Australian Outback, passing desert landscape, spotting camels, cattle and Atila (Mt. Conner), before turning the corner at Erldunda. Pause for a break at Stuart Wells, an authentic Outback roadhouse. Before arriving at Alice Springs, you'll divert to the West MacDonnell Ranges to explore the rugged beauty of spectacular Simpsons Gap. Upon arrival at your Alice Springs hotel, relax before a celebratory dinner.
